Markets, manages and underwrites new, profitable surety business production, through direct and in person contact with select agencies or brokers. Drives profit and premium to meet financial goals and objectives through development, negotiation and execution of business plans. Collaborates with internal partners to extract new business from the agency force to review, quote, inspect and issue. Expands and enhances agency/company relationships for the purposes of writing new business. Under limited direction, underwrites accounts based on authority level granted to the role and underwriting appetite. Authority is granted based on experience and expertise.

Job Description

Key Responsibilities:

  • Monitors market conditions, competitive landscape, and confirms information gathered within market space. Researches risk, environment and factors necessary to win the account. Additional and more complex research may be required to appropriately assess more complex accounts.

  • Analyzes quality and quantity of risks underwritten and prepares reports accordingly. Accurately evaluates complex risk exposures and ensures review of financial documents, credit reports, bank and other underwriting documents.

  • Accepts, rejects, or modifies new commercial lines business to ensure profitability. Prices business according to company underwriting and pricing guidelines, and ensures standards for timelines are met. Reviews for acceptability and handles those within authority using company underwriting guidelines and standards.

  • Manages workflow and intricacies of underwriting more complex assigned work, utilizing company tools and systems to meet service level agreements. Ensures file handling quality and workflow efficiency with a thorough understanding of overall surety strategic direction and operating plans.

  • Key contributor to robust agency business development planning discussions. Develops annual DWP goals with assigned agents and develops plans in partnership with agents to achieve annual production goals.

  • Markets surety products to help drive agency and company results. Assists agency with strategies for pipeline management and to develop new business in targeted industries and preferred markets. Responds effectively to assess accounts and develop business propositions to win the business. Makes accurate assessments of future agency potential and is able to communicate/discuss the assessment with agency partners in a positive and professional manner.

  • Consults with agents, accounts and internal partners to resolve business issues and makes recommendations based on findings. Shares understanding of organizational capabilities and opportunities to drive maximum value of relationships. Consults regarding the appetite, acceptability, terms, conditions, pricing and sales techniques of large or complex accounts. Provides industry trend observations to leadership.

  • Effectively communicates with agencies to establish the company as the surety provider of choice for the territory. Communicates product, technology changes and company objectives. Communicates and collaborates actively with leadership to share industry trends and field underwriting experience.

  • Completes agency visits, as appropriate, to develop new accounts, service existing accounts, review agency performance and enhance agency relationship. Establishes and maintains strong business relationships with agencies, producers and key groups.

  • Leads delivery of appropriate customer service levels. Follows up and ensures proper handling of advanced customer service requests.

  • Ensures that tools, training and support are in place to positively impact success for assigned agencies. Identifies and communicates training needs and opportunities. Participates in program and product orientation meetings in conjunction with Sales/Marketing partners as the underwriting subject matter authority. Provides professional development knowledge and insight to team members. May help mentor new field underwriters and provide coaching.

  • Proven ability to manage heavy workload effectively and backup other team members as needed.

May perform other responsibilities as assigned.

Reporting Relationships: Reports to manager or director. No direct reports.
